Bus information Saint-Hyacinthe - Guelph

The Saint-Hyacinthe - Guelph route has approximately 2 frequencies and its minimum duration is around 16h 30min. It is important you book your ticket in advance to avoid running out, since CDN$ 71.21 tickets tend to run out quickly.
The distance between Saint-Hyacinthe and Guelph is around 715 kilometers and the bus companies that can help you in your journey are: Greyhound, Orléans Express.
Remember that the number of transfers to be made will be at least 2 so in some cases you should book the tickets separately.
